Chalis Butler never expected to find herself at the end of a failed marriage just six weeks in. Brought up in the Christian faith, she spent a lifetime trying to do everything right only to find herself at her lowest point, facing heartbreak and deep disillusionment. In search of answers, Butler embarked on a personal journey of healing and self-discovery. Now, in Return to Real, she is able to share her story of redemption.

For anyone who has ever found themselves at a low point, feeling broken-hearted, confused, or in need of direction, this book will serve as an honest and wise companion in the struggle. Beyond sharing her own story with vulnerability, compassion, and humor, Butler lays out five principles, or keys that will help readers face the past, find joy in the present, and have hope for the future.

Includes thought provoking questions perfect for small groups or individual reflection.
